WARNING SIGNS YOU NEED TILE FLOOR WATER DAMAGE RESTORATION

Water damage can sneak up on you, but knowing the warning signs can save you time, money, and stress. Here are a few common sign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ent musty smell can show moisture buildup in your tile floors. Don’t ignore it, address the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.

Warped or Buckled Tiles

Warped or buckled tiles can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your tiles are warping or buckling, it’s time to call a professional.

Discolored Grout or Tiles

Discolored grout or tiles can be a sign of water damage. Regular cleaning and maintenance can help prevent this issue, but if you notice discoloration, it’s best to address it quickly.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old and mildew growth can be a serious health risk. If you notice any signs of mold or mildew on your tile floors, it’s essential to address the issue immediately.

Water Stains or Rings

Water stains or rings on your tile floors can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ore them, address the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.

Soft or Spongy Tiles

Soft or spongy tiles can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your tiles are soft or spongy, it’s time to call a professional.

TILE FLOOR WATER DAMAGE RESTORATION VS. DIY: WHEN TO CALL A PRO

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on a single tile Yes No You can easily clean and dry the tile on your own.
Warped or buckled tiles No Yes Professional help is required to repair and restore the tile.
M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ew growth can be a serious health risk and need professional removal and remediation.
Water damage to multiple rooms or floors No Yes Professional help is required to assess and address the damage, and prevent further damage.
Water damage to a large area or with extensive structural damage No Yes Professional help is required to assess and address the damage, and prevent further damage.

TILE FLOOR WATER DAMAGE RESTORATION COST IN JUSTIN, TX

The cost of tile floor water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Justin,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and amount of water extracted.
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area and complexity of drying process.
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and complexity of repairs.
Final Inspection and C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and complexity of cleaning process.
